How Much Does HVAC Cost in Denver?

For most homeowners in Denver, HVAC repairs typically range from $150 to $700, while full system installations generally fall between $3,500 and $7,500 depending on the equipment and specific home requirements. HVAC Cost Breakdown (2026)

We believe in straight talk about what things cost in the Denver market. Because we have served this community for over 8 years, we know that no two homes are exactly the same, but we can provide reliable ranges based on our experience with local systems.

Service Type Estimated Cost Range
AC Repair $150 - $650
Furnace Repair $150 - $700
AC Installation $3,500 - $7,500
Seasonal Tune-Up $80 - $200

When you look at these numbers, keep in mind that the final cost of a repair often depends on the age of your system and the complexity of the part required. For instance, a simple capacitor replacement on a unit in a home in Park Hill will cost significantly less than a blower motor replacement on a high-efficiency system in a sprawling home in Cherry Creek. What Affects HVAC Pricing in Denver

Understanding why HVAC pricing varies helps you make better decisions for your home. We see these five factors influence costs most often in our daily work across the Denver metro area.

  • Equipment Efficiency Ratings: Higher SEER2 ratings for air conditioners or AFUE ratings for furnaces carry a higher upfront cost but often lower the monthly utility bills. We help you balance the initial investment against long-term energy savings.
  • System Capacity and Home Size: The square footage of your home and the quality of your insulation dictate the size of the unit you need. Installing a unit that is too large or too small for your home leads to inefficiency and premature wear.
  • Ductwork Condition: In many of the older neighborhoods like Washington Park or Highlands, we often find original ductwork that requires modification or sealing to support a modern, high-efficiency system.
  • Installation Complexity: Access to your equipment matters. If your furnace is tucked into a tight, unfinished crawlspace or a cramped closet, it requires more labor hours to safely remove the old unit and install the new one.

Safety and Professional Care

When dealing with your HVAC system, especially furnaces and gas-fired equipment, safety is the first priority. Because these systems involve high-voltage electricity and natural gas lines, we strongly advise against attempting internal repairs yourself. Attempting to bypass safety switches or working on gas valves without specialized training can lead to carbon monoxide leaks or fire hazards. Is it cheaper to repair or replace an HVAC system?

If your system is under 10 years old and the repair cost is less than 50% of the value of the unit, a repair is usually the most cost-effective path. However, if you are constantly paying for repairs on a 15-year-old unit, replacing it with a modern, efficient model will save you money on utility bills and eliminate the stress of recurring breakdowns.
